From reading my 92 FSM, I note that the reverse signal in C239 is cavity D
which is a BLUE 10 cavity connector.
In C209, the signal is in cavity F of a 15 cavity BLACK connector.

I'm looking at the 92 Electrical Supplement, 8A-202-14 and 15.

Diagram is 8A-112-0 in the supplement

The connector in your snapshot is C238 (G-LT GRN is 2d fuel related, K- BLU is AC related, J-BRN/WHT CEL/SES related, F - should be brown). Turn that connector and A should be DK BLU/WHT & B should be DK GRN/WHT. I didn't go further. Confirm those colors as correct and move on to a different choice.

In your #14 snapshot ID the cavities and wire colors of the adjacent connector. In the wire bundle you've got wire colors that look to be appropriate.

C209 uses an 8 pin mating and a 7 pin mating connector, F is in the 8pin mating connector. Look at the link to locobob's install (black is the C209 and the clear is the 8 pin mating. If he were to turn that over there would be a 7 pin mating.

I was actually editing my #16 post and making it easier to maybe use locobob's snapshots.

I gave you a way to "confirm" not just my WAG here in the hills of WV. I've never had C239 in my hand and the FSM is riddled with connector misinformation. An example is C239 - on 8A-202-14 C210/C239 is ID'd as same, 8A-202-15 as different. Delphi says that 8A-202-15 is correct and both connectors male/female should be BLUE.

Now you've got the connector you need to work with unless you also put your hands on the C209 and it was easier to manipulate.

Were it here I might choose the 8 pin mating for the C209 because it might be easier to unlatch, remove the wire, crimp a new terminal with a pigtail to use for the RVC. The terminals are an easy source for me.

The first image I posted way back isn't in the '92 and earlier FSM because the CDM is right there also and they couldn't image that area as easily under the dash. Get the CDM out of the way and it should be much easier and maybe resemble the later image I posted back there.
